Have you heard about "imposter syndrome"? What if we said it's not what you've been told it is?
In this bonus episode, Jenny speaks with Lacey Filipich about the myth that women suffer from "imposter syndrome" and can't negotiate salaries (among other things, like the graduate pay gap).
Lacey Filipich helps people become financially independent and reclaim their lives. Thousands around the world have used her Money School courses to liberate themselves from debt, start saving, and raise financially capable kids.
Money School is also the title of her international award-winning book, out now with Penguin Life.
Lacey graduated as valedictorian from the University of Queensland with an Honours degree in Chemical Engineering (if you want to find out how a chemical engineer ends up teaching people about money, check out her TEDx talk.) She is the winner of a 2019 Business News '40 under 40’ Award and a LinkedIn Top Voice in Finance.
